D. Rogalla et al., Recoil separator ERNA*: improved measurements of the astrophysical key reaction C-12(alpha,gamma)O-16, NUCL PHYS A, 688(1-2), 2001, pp. 549C-551C
The recoil separator ERNA (European Recoil Separator for Nuclear Astrophysi
cs) for improved measurements of the astrophysical key reaction C-12(alpha,
gamma)O-16 is being developed at the 4 MV Dynamitron tandem accelerator in
Bochum to detect directly the O-16 recoils. The total detection efficiency
of about 50 % allows direct measurements in a much wider energy range than
previously accessible. In addition this technique allows improved measurem
ents not hampered by cosmic background problems when compared to gamma -ray
detection.
